this scene kinda make it clear to me that raph respects the hell out of mike. in this entire episode raph only ever gets anywhere by talking. the one time he tries to fight back he just makes everything worse. it's only now that he purposefully listens to him
i'm about to do a big ol reach, but i think the first three episodes do an absolutely great job explaining why raph and mike are best friends just through subtext.
so for one thing, i'm gonna ignore how don ties into this because he's his whole other can of worms. he's THE middle child. he's kinda purposefully separate from his brothers.
ok back to it. leo's episode kind of perfectly sets up mike's. his entire episode relies really heavily on their relationship i think. hell, the episode's cold open is quite literally introduced by leo. mike mentions him a lot, about how he doesn't know what to do, that he's not good at planning, when we see multiple times throughout the episode that mike CAN plan. the entire zoo plot was clearly his idea. him 'improvising' IS planning, even if it's just in the moment.
in contrast, leo's episode kinda... disregards his bros entirely. his account is the meanest out of all of them, especially how he portrays mike. as for mike, based on his account he's under the impression that he just flat out can't do anything unless leo says it first, and that leo blames him for everything going wrong. like i've talked about it before but like- it genuinely really upsets me lol. anyway their relationship is very obviously strained. hell, they don't even hug when they reunite in 'the pearl,' and it's immediately contrasted with mike running to hug raph once he spots him. it just really says a lot i think.
but whatever this ain't about them! so far, raph is the only one of mike's brothers whose taken him seriously. even in mutant mayhem, the way leo talks to mike is demeaning at BEST, and just plain mean at worst. even when raph is teasing mike, he's listening to him. like i genuinely think that flashback is so important because it doesn't cut out anything mike said. even if raph teased him about it, raph still listened. he remembers what mike said, and it's literally the only reason he was able to survive.
i feel like mike realizes this, and that's why he's so damn attached to raph. like i just noticed this super recently, but mike is noticeably unemotive when you compare him to his older brothers, and pretty much the only times his voice breaks, or his face becomes more expressive is when raph teases him, or when he's actually being hurt. like if i remember correctly, he barely reacted to leo saying he's not funny. but raph telling mike that he screwed up (and that it was fine), made him visibly pout.
and imo, it's totally because raph treats him with some sense of autonomy. raph's not constantly ignoring him, he's not constantly telling mike what to do.
anyway. 'the relationships between the mutant mayhem boys aren't developed,' my ass.

Little habits whumpee may not realise is a result of trauma
-Always knowing where every exit is. And always being near an exit.
-Always keeping their back to the wall, never wanting to be caught in an open space.
-Obsessively locking every door, every window, even their own bedroom. They won't relax otherwise.
-Brushing off compliments.
-Being overly defensive.
-Extreme independence. Never relying on anyone, they are fully capable of doing things alone and they are determined to
-Walking quickly. Never lingering, not even for a moment.
-Standing hunched, head down, making themselves as small and inconspicuous as possible. They wear loose, basic clothing, trying to both hide themselves and not stand out
-Lapses in memory. Especially not remembering childhood memories
-Never expressing excitement or want for anything. Never hoping for anything.
-In the same vein, never admit to enjoying anything. They fear they will be mocked, or it will be taken away. Anything can be used against them in some way.
-Being excellent in a crisis, even if they panic in minor situations.
